Foundation Repair Costs - Typical expenses for cracked foundation repair services range from $2,000 to $7,000. The total cost depends on the extent of damage and the repair method used, with minor cracks often costing less and extensive repairs costing more.
Labor and Materials - Labor costs can account for about 50% of the total repair expense, which varies based on local rates. Material costs for epoxy injections or underpinning generally range from $500 to $3,000, depending on the repair type.
Type of Repair - The specific repair approach influences costs, with simple crack sealing typically costing around $500 to $1,500. More involved solutions like piering or underpinning can range from $3,000 to over $10,000 for larger or more complex projects.
Additional Expenses - Extra costs may include foundation assessment, soil stabilization, or excavation, which can add $1,000 to $5,000 to the overall price. The total cost varies based on property size and foundation condition, with local pros providing detailed estimates.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of a cracked foundation? Visible cracks in walls, uneven floors, and doors or windows that don't close properly are typical indicators of foundation issues.
How long does foundation repair usually take? The duration varies depending on the extent of the damage, but most repairs can be completed within a few days to a week.
Are foundation repairs disruptive to daily activities? Some level of disruption may occur, but experienced contractors aim to minimize impact during the repair process.
What causes foundation cracks in homes? Factors like soil movement, moisture changes, and poor drainage can contribute to foundation cracking.
How can I prevent future foundation problems? Proper drainage, maintaining soil moisture levels, and addressing minor issues early can help prevent further damage.
